Description

Sought after cabin at Harstene Pointes' friendly waterfront, gated community. Live here full time or let this be your vacation getaway just a couple hours from Seattle. 2 Bedrooms, 1 full bath nestled in a tranquil park like setting. New roof, shiplapped walls, and flooring. A cozy propane freestanding stove for warmth & ambiance. Community pool/clubhouse/bbqs, tennis/sport courts, fitness center. Miles of beaches on Case Inlet. (Make sure to view the beaches from both sides of the point). Don't miss the marina, 2 boat launches & covered picnic areas. 5.5 miles of trails. Paved roads to bike ride. Bring your boat, jetskis or kayak or just come to relax. This is the perfect escape.
